Los indomables is an intriguing entry in the western genre, offering a gritty atmosphere that captures the essence of the lawless frontier. The film’s pacing is deliberate, allowing for character development, especially between the seasoned lawman and the young gunman, Nick Sanders. Their evolving relationship adds an emotional layer, while the brutal nature of Big Bill injects tension. What stands out is the raw, practical effects that lend an authenticity to the violence and action scenes, grounding the narrative in a stark reality. The performances, particularly the chemistry between the leads, make the film notable in its portrayal of redemption and survival amidst chaos.
Los indomables has maintained a niche appeal among collectors, partly due to its limited release and the mystery surrounding its director. The film was released on various formats over the years, but original prints are becoming scarce, heightening its collector interest. The unique take on the western genre, combined with practical effects, makes it a distinctive piece worth noting in any serious collection.
